Clear Angle Studios launches modular Volumetric Capture Rig

Clear Angle Studios launches Volumetric Capture RigThe VCR solution is the first purpose-built 4D Gaussian splatting capture system from Clear Angle Studios, the preferred scanning provider for Disney, Universal, Netflix and more.

The modular Volumetric Capture Rig for high-end VFX production now announced by Clear Angle Studios is an advanced system for dynamic Gaussian splat capture that provides VFX artists with photoreal dynamic assets, recreating real-world performances faithfully in digital scenes. The approach provides opportunity for reduced production costs, and has contributed to the development of new approaches for re-lighting.

The global market-leader in high-end 3D and 4D capture, Clear Angle Studios says that the new capture system is the “culmination of 13 years of innovation” and follows the success of the “Dorothy” facial capture and full-body systems utilized by major studios like Disney, Universal, and Netflix.

As expectations of realism in Film, TV, and streaming continue to rise, audiences are increasingly quick to spot artificial digital elements or inconsistencies in lighting and movement. The VCR has been developed to meet growing industry demand for highly believable digital performances, with fewer manual post-production steps and greater realism, on tight production schedules.

Designed to be adaptable for the specific requirements of each shoot, the rig can be configured for a range of applications; from close-up facial capture and single performer work, to stunt performance, group crowds, and larger volumetric performance spaces. With the VCR, productions can capture dynamic performances in a studio which VFX teams can then authentically replicate into a CG environment. For example, large crowd scenes can be populated with extremely lightweight, photoreal Gaussian splat assets, with performers captured in groups in the VCR and re-lit in post.

According to Clear Angle Studios, this approach also reduces costs for VFX teams, where a Gaussian splat workflow can require far fewer production hours to reach the final product than a standard pipeline. Current workflows relying on reconstructed geometry involve significant manual cleanup, texturing, lighting and animation in post-production to provide a photo-real result. A Gaussian splat asset, by contrast, inherently preserves the exact original behavior and natural lighting of the captured performance, providing high-fidelity datasets in a fraction of the time.

The VCR was first showcased in partnership with Union VFX, who utilized Clear Angle Studios’ data to develop a groundbreaking re-lighting solution for Gaussian splats. The ability to re-light a Gaussian splat is crucial to utilizing these assets when captured under scene lighting isn’t possible. Having a pipeline for re-lighting enables productions to capture a performance in the VCR and tailor it perfectly to the specific lighting environment of any scene. Combining Clear Angle Studios’ capture capabilities and Union’s creative visual effects production expertise, the companies were able to deliver a relightable Gaussian-splat-based crowd solution, the first of its kind in use on a major film.
